The new partnership between Justin Willett, Etienne de Montille and Rodolphe Péters is off to a very strong start. The heart of this new estate is the former Wenzlau property, which Racines now controls through a long-term lease. So far, I have only tasted the Chardonnays and Pinots. Stylistically, the wines are a bit bigger and richer than, for example, the wines Willett makes at Tyler. Some of that, of course, may be attributable to site. The Pinots in particular feel more deeper and more extracted, with greater whole cluster influence and also a bit more density from eighteen months in oak. Needless to say, it will be fascinating to see what the range looks like once the sparkling wines are ready to go.
